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 12-08-2003, 10:04   #1 (permalink)
A..
PostTraum
 
Registriert seit: Apr 2003
Beiträge: 300
kl. Prob mit mp3 loadSound

Hallo mal wieder,

ich habe ein Prob einen Ladevorgang von soundLoad abzubrechen und zwar so das der mainfilm auch weiterhin andere filme in mcempty reinlädt.
Aber sobald ich einen song in den mcplayer lade und diesen mittem im laden abbreche um einen anderen mc in empty reinladen will ... läd der main-swf film nichts mehr in den mcempty nach.

Kann man mp3 load irgendwie abbrechen oder radikal löschen? So das der Film auch weiterhin filme reinläde?

Also wenn mir einer helfen könnte wär ganz cool - fänd ich jetzt mal.

danke
a..
A.. ist offline   Mit Zitat antworten
Alt 12-08-2003, 12:32   #2 (permalink)
_//\\#//\\_
 
Benutzerbild von warrantmaster
 
Registriert seit: Jan 2003
Beiträge: 7.060
radikal würde ich es machen, indem ich bei jedem klick auf einen
load-button den mcempty mit einem neuen mcempty überschreiben würde (createEmptyMovieClip).
mußt halt nur darauf achten, daß in der ebene nixx anderes liegt...
warrantmaster ist offline   Mit Zitat antworten
Alt 12-08-2003, 13:18   #3 (permalink)
A..
PostTraum
 
Registriert seit: Apr 2003
Beiträge: 300
nunja hehhe

oje ja danke aber moment

i hob
main.swf
in dem liegen MCs
nav = navigation
empty = da kommen die inhalt die per navigationsreingeladen werden.
player = da läuft der player wenn verlängt

player hat zwei keyframes
1: pause
2: dynamische loadSound Geschichte

wenn ich jetzt einen navigationspunkt auswähle ging bisher der player auf pause. und der song stoppte aber beim o-test. hängt sich empty bzw jede loadMovie anweisung ob jpg oder swf auf hmmm.....

Issen bisserl schwer jetzt den ganzen zusammenhang zu erklären aber du meinst.
bei

ActionScript:
  1. bt_[I]n[/I].on release function () {
  2. player.createEmptyMovieClip("player",1000);
  3. }

hmm und lade dann wieder den player rein wenn ich mich in der audiosection befinde. Also radikal der vorher reingeladenen player löschen und neu"bauen" und den "frischen" player wieder reinladen?

gruss
a..
A.. ist offline   Mit Zitat antworten
Alt 12-08-2003, 13:30   #4 (permalink)
_//\\#//\\_
 
Benutzerbild von warrantmaster
 
Registriert seit: Jan 2003
Beiträge: 7.060
naja, ich kenne die strukturen natürlich nicht, aber den ganzen player zu killen ist viellecht etwas "mehr" radikal

ActionScript:
  1. bt_n.on release function () {
  2.         player.createEmptyMovieClip("empty",da_wo_empty_liegt);
  3. player.empty.load.....
  4. }

deine mp3 wrden doch in den empty geladen, also überschreib den einfach.
warrantmaster ist offline   Mit Zitat antworten
Alt 12-08-2003, 13:51   #5 (permalink)
A..
PostTraum
 
Registriert seit: Apr 2003
Beiträge: 300
hehhehe sorri jetzt wird commplicated

also ich hab eine
movieclip in empty der beinhaltet
eine regeladene xml liste die flash als tabelle darstellt. (also kein plan von php *oink ).
Nunja wenn jetzt der user aus den playliste ein lied auswählt, legt ein button names download folgendes fest und zwar den namen für die zu ladende mp3 file

ActionScript:
  1. download.onRelease = function() {
  2.     if (endung == "mp3") {
  3.     _root.player.gotoAndStop("pause");
  4.     _root.player.songname = (("audio/mp3/"+titel)+".mp3");
  5.     _root.player.gotoAndStop("audioon");};}
so jetzt weiss der _root.player clip wie der name lautet. und hüpftet von pause nach audioon. So, hier wird der song per

ActionScript:
  1. plSong = new Sound(this);
  2. plSong.loadSound(songname, false);

geladen.

Wenn ich jetzt aber !!! eine andere swf in meinen emtpy reinladen will.
Geht das loadMovie ins empty nicht mehr und nur weil loadSound im MC player in noch am röddeln ist.

ich glaube ich habe mich verbaut .
A.. ist offline   Mit Zitat antworten
Alt 12-08-2003, 14:03   #6 (permalink)
_//\\#//\\_
 
Benutzerbild von warrantmaster
 
Registriert seit: Jan 2003
Beiträge: 7.060
harr...so langsam kommen wir der sache näher.

simpel und radikal: den button, über den man in den empty-mc laden kann während des ladens des sounds abschalten.
wenn sound fertig geladen...wieder anschalten.
das ganze funzt über enabled=false/true.


...ist radikal
warrantmaster ist offline   Mit Zitat antworten
Alt 12-08-2003, 14:11   #7 (permalink)
A..
PostTraum
 
Registriert seit: Apr 2003
Beiträge: 300
:lol

ahah sehr gut nunja hmmmm ich kann doch net einfach sagen so lieber user jetzt wartest du mal!

wenn der user sich gerade verklickt hat? hehehe und wollte eigentlich nix klicken?

okay ich blende dann einfach "TILT!!!" ein...


okayokay

an dieses radikal hab ich auch schon gedacht aber hmmm gibt es war sanfteres ?

gruss
a...
A.. ist offline   Mit Zitat antworten
Alt 12-08-2003, 14:18   #8 (permalink)
_//\\#//\\_
 
Benutzerbild von warrantmaster
 
Registriert seit: Jan 2003
Beiträge: 7.060
hmm...

ich hab jetzt hier kein flash, aber eventuell solltest du beim buttoklick dann das soundobjekt plSong deleten. mußt mal probieren.
warrantmaster ist offline   Mit Zitat antworten
Alt 12-08-2003, 14:21   #9 (permalink)
A..
PostTraum
 
Registriert seit: Apr 2003
Beiträge: 300
okay danke ich hatte das mit delete fast scho wieder aufgebeben hmmm muss mal sehen ob ich auch die richtige stellt pfad etcetc hatte ...
aber thanks for u patience

gruss
a..
A.. ist offline   Mit Zitat antworten
Alt 12-08-2003, 15:06   #10 (permalink)
A..
PostTraum
 
Registriert seit: Apr 2003
Beiträge: 300
iuiuiiuiuii

Schande über mich

ich hab die anderen swf die in empty reingeladen werden sollen zum test garnet hochgeladen hehehehe *oinkoink
A.. 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 18:26 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ele